Polyester resin is commonly used to bond the fibreglass on the inside of many "wet" appliances, including dishwashers and washing machines. These resins are advanced products of saturated acids (such as isophthalic acid and phthalic acid) and unsaturated acids (such as maleic or fumaric acid), condensed with dihydric alcohols. An unsaturated polyester resin (UPR) is a form of thermoset moulding resin that is used for the manufacturing of glass fiber reinforced plastics (FRP). POLYESTER RESINS, are a group of thermosetting synthetic resins, which are poly condensation products of dicarboxylic acids with dihydroxy alcohol’s, used along with Fibre Glass Mats for production of FRP Components which are durable and outstanding in Mechanical, Electrical and Chemical properties. Many decorative architectural details such as columns and balustrades can be carved from hard foam, coated with fibreglass and polyester resin for strength and weatherproofing, and painted to match the building. Some of the other end-use industries where unsaturated polyester resins are widely used include artificial stones, electrical, aerospace, wind energy, and automotive.
